Understanding the Belgium Driving License

In Belgium, driving licenses are released and handled by the Federal Public Service (FPS) Mobility and Transport. The licenses are vital for legal driving and are categorized into several classifications, depending upon the kind of lorry you are allowed to operate.

Kinds Of Belgium Driving Licenses

  • Category B: Standard traveler automobiles.
  • Category A: Motorcycles and scooters.
  • Classification C: Heavier items lorries.
  • Category D: Buses and public transportation cars.

Steps for Buying a Replacement Belgium Driving License

Action 1: Report the Loss or Theft

The first action to take if your driving license is lost or taken is to report it to the regional authorities. This action is crucial as it protects you against prospective deceptive use of your identity documents. Make certain to obtain a cops report, as you will require this when looking for a replacement.

Action 2: Gather Required Documentation

When making an application for a replacement license, certain documents will be required. Below is an extensive list of necessary documents:

  • Identity Card: A legitimate Belgian identity card or passport.
  • Cops Report: If appropriate, a copy of the cops report regarding the lost or taken license.
  • Medical Certificate: Depending on your age and the kind of license, a medical assessment might be needed.
  • Proof of Residence: A current utility costs or main file revealing your address.
  • Application Form: A finished application for a replacement license, which can normally be obtained from regional towns or online.

Action 3: Submit the Application

With all documents ready, you must submit your application to your regional town (commune) or the significant licensing authority. Keep in mind that some towns may need you to establish a consultation beforehand.

Step 4: Pay the Fees

A non-refundable application charge is usually associated with getting a replacement driving license. The cost can vary based on the town, so it is advisable to inquire about the specific amount at your local office.

Step 5: Wait for Processing

After submitting your application, there might be a waiting period. Normally, the processing time can vary from a couple of days to numerous weeks, depending upon the town and any potential backlogs.

Action 6: Receive Your Replacement License

When your application is processed and authorized, you will get your replacement driving license.  Highly recommended Reading  is crucial to check that all your details are appropriate upon receipt to prevent any future inconsistencies.

FAQs Regarding Replacement of Belgium Driving License

1. Can I request a replacement driving license online?

Yes, depending upon the town, some may provide online applications. Check your regional commune's website for the offered services.

2. The length of time is a replacement driving license valid?

A replacement driving license is normally legitimate for the exact same period as your original license, supplied it has actually not ended.

3. Do I need to take a driving test to get a replacement?

No, a replacement license does not require retaking the driving test, offered you had a valid license formerly.

4. What should I do if I discover my lost driving license afterward?

If you locate your original license after obtaining a replacement, it is a good idea to return the old one to the regional municipality.

5. What can I do if my driving license is expired?

If your license is ended, you will require to renew it instead of merely replacing it. The renewal process might involve extra requirements.
